small函数(small函数的使用方法)

大家好,今天来为大家分享small函数的一些知识点,和small函数的使用方法的问题解析,大家要是都明白,那么可以忽略,如果不太清楚的话可以看看本篇文章,相信很大概率可以解决您的问题,接下来我们就一起来看看吧!

在编程的世界里,函数无处不在,它们如同魔法一样,让代码变得灵活、高效。而在众多函数中,有一种被称为“small函数”的特殊存在,它们小巧玲珑,却又蕴含着强大的功能。small函数究竟有何特殊之处?本文将带您走进small函数的神秘世界,一探究竟。

一、什么是small函数?

我们先来了解一下什么是small函数。small函数,顾名思义,就是指那些功能简单、代码量少的函数。它们通常只完成一项或几项具体任务,如计算两个数的和、获取当前日期等。

特点

1. 功能单一:small函数只负责完成一项任务,如获取当前日期、计算两个数的和等。

2. 代码量少:small函数的代码量通常在几行到几十行之间,易于阅读和理解。

3. 易于维护:由于small函数功能单一,修改和扩展起来更加方便。

二、small函数的应用场景

small函数的应用场景非常广泛,以下列举一些常见的场景:

1. 数据处理

* 获取当前日期

* 计算两个数的和

* 获取字符串的长度

2. 算法实现

* 冒泡排序

* 选择排序

* 快速排序

3. 数据结构操作

* 链表插入

* 链表删除

* 树的遍历

4. 工具函数

* 字符串格式化

* 数字格式化

* 日期格式化

三、small函数的优势

相较于大型函数,small函数具有以下优势:

1. 代码可读性强

由于small函数功能单一,代码结构清晰,易于阅读和理解。

2. 维护成本低

small函数易于修改和扩展,降低了维护成本。

3. 提高代码复用性

将功能单一的任务封装成small函数,可以在多个地方复用,提高代码复用性。

4. 便于单元测试

small函数易于进行单元测试,确保代码质量。

四、如何编写高效的small函数?

编写高效的small函数,需要注意以下几点:

1. 明确功能

在编写small函数之前,要明确其功能,避免功能过多或过少。

2. 简洁的代码

尽量使用简洁的代码,避免冗余和重复。

3. 适当的命名

给small函数起一个清晰、易懂的名称,便于阅读和理解。

4. 注意性能

对于一些性能要求较高的small函数,要注意代码的性能。

五、总结

small函数虽然小巧玲珑,但却在编程中发挥着重要作用。掌握small函数的编写技巧,有助于提高代码质量,降低维护成本。在编程过程中,我们要善于发现并利用small函数,让代码更加高效、易读。

以下是一个small函数的示例

“`python

def add(a, b):

excel中small函数有什么作用

SMALL函数的作用是:在一列数值中,按从小到大的顺序取第n个值。

例如:=SMALL(A1:A10,5),意思是,从A1:A10的10个数值,从小到大取第5个。

具体操作如下:

1、small函数:返回数据中第K个最小值。

2、small函数的语法格式:SMALL(array,k)。array为数据的范围。k为返回的数据在数据区域里的位置(从小到大)。

3、输入公式=SMALL(A1:A10,5)。

4、输入公式=SMALL(A1:A10,2)。

5、求最后三名的姓名,输入公式=VLOOKUP(SMALL(B2:B10,1),CHOOSE({1,2},B2:B10,A2:A10),2,0)。这样就完成了数据的填写。

excel中的small函数怎么用

Excel中的SMALL函数用于返回数据集中第k小的数值,基本语法为=SMALL(数组, k),其中k为正整数,表示要返回的第k小的位置。

查找单个最小值若需找出B2:B11区域中的最小值(即第1小的数),在目标单元格(如D4)输入公式:=SMALL(B2:B11,1)按回车键即可显示结果。

查找单个最大值若需找出B2:B11区域中的最大值(即第n大的数,n为数据总数),需将k设为数据范围的总个数。例如,若B2:B11共10个数据,在D6单元格输入:=SMALL(B2:B11,10)按回车键即可显示结果。

查找多个第k小的数值若需同时找出第4至第6小的数,需使用数组公式:

选中存放结果的连续单元格区域(如D8:D10)。

输入公式时需对数据范围使用绝对引用(如$B$2:$B$11),并输入数组形式的公式(如=SMALL($B$2:$B$11,{4,5,6}))。

同时按下Ctrl+Shift+Enter组合键,Excel会自动在公式两端添加大括号{},表示数组公式生效。

注意事项

数据范围需包含所有待分析数值,且k值不能超过数据总数,否则返回错误值#NUM!。查找多个数值时,必须使用Ctrl+Shift+Enter组合键,普通回车键无法生成正确结果。公式中的逗号、括号等符号需使用英文半角字符,避免因符号格式错误导致计算失败。

Excel中small函数的使用方法

SMALL函数用于返回数据中第K个最小值。以下是具体使用方法:

语法格式SMALL(array, k)array:需要查找的数据范围(如单元格区域A1:A10)。

k:返回第几个最小值(按从小到大排序后的位置,必须为正整数且不超过数据范围的数量)。

基础案例

返回A1:A10区域中第5小的值:=SMALL(A1:A10, 5)

返回A1:A10区域中第2小的值:=SMALL(A1:A10, 2)

进阶应用:结合其他函数

求最后三名的姓名(假设分数在B2:B10,姓名在A2:A10):公式:=VLOOKUP(SMALL(B2:B10,1), CHOOSE({1,2}, B2:B10, A2:A10), 2, 0)逻辑说明:SMALL(B2:B10,1)返回B列最小分数。

CHOOSE({1,2}, B2:B10, A2:A10)将B列和A列组合为虚拟数组(分数在前,姓名在后)。

VLOOKUP根据最小分数查找对应姓名。扩展:将公式中的1改为2或3,可分别获取倒数第二、第三名的姓名。

注意事项

若k值超过数据范围数量(如数据有5个,但k=6),公式会返回错误#NUM!。

数据范围需为数值型,文本或空单元格可能导致错误。

结合IFERROR函数可优化错误处理,例如:=IFERROR(SMALL(A1:A10,5),"数据不足")

如果你还想了解更多这方面的信息,记得收藏关注本站。

© 版权声明
THE END
喜欢就支持一下吧
点赞10 分享